A classic crispy Austrian dish made of veal cutlets, breadcrumbs and butter
Preparation time: 10 Minutes
Cooking time: 15 Minutes
Total duration: 25 Minutes
Calories: 498; Total Fat: 21.6g; Cholesterol: 125mg; Sodium: 775mg; Total Carbohydrates: 37.5g; Protein: 30.3g
Wiener Schnitzel is a traditional Austrian dish made of veal cutlets, breadcrumbs and butter. It is usually served with a side of potatoes or salad and lemon wedges. It is a popular dish in Vienna and is served in many restaurants in the city.
Season the veal cutlets with salt and pepper
Dip the cutlets in the flour
Dip the cutlets in the egg mixture
Dip the cutlets in the breadcrumbs
Fry the cutlets in butter
